Wayne Public Library Weekly Schedule

WAYNE – Another month full of activities for youth and adults are being planned for at the Wayne Public Library.

According to a release, the Wayne Public Library is located at 410 Pearl Street.

2024 Calendar – May

Become a member of the Herb Club where every month a new take-and-make kit will be available, including one herb sample, recipes and tips for using the herb, as well as suggested cookbooks for using the herb that are available for checkout in the library collection.

A community potluck based around all of the herbs has been scheduled for August 17 at 5 p.m. This month’s herb is Rosemary.

Adult craft night is scheduled for Tuesday, May 7 at 6 p.m. The group will be making gnomes.

Adult Coloring will return on Tuesday, May 14 at 6 p.m. in the back of the library. Stop in for a relaxing night and good company. Colors, coloring sheets and snacks are provided sponsored by the Endicott Family.

This month’s trivia night will be a 2000s theme on Friday, May 17 at 7 p.m. from Johnnie Byrd Brewing Company in the Coop. Register your team of four to six people at the library as space is limited for this first-come, first-serve event. Prizes for the overall champion and best-dressed will be awarded.

Mark Tuesday, May 21 on the calendar between 6 – 7 p.m. for basic tech help. Stop by the library if you have questions about your devices or basic computer skills. Attendees can also use this session to enhance tech knowledge and make the most of your devices.

Teens and Tweens are invited to participate in Lo-Fi Friday on May 23 at 3:30 p.m. A relaxation day will be offered including bath bombs, a thought journal, aroma therapy and more.

Needle night continues each Thursday at 6:30 p.m. at the library. Enjoy conversation and good company while working on your personal needlework projects. All kinds of decorative sewing and textile arts handicrafts are welcome.

Book club will return on Tuesday, May 28 at 6:30 p.m. from the library conference room. The monthly book pick is ‘Giants in the Earth’ by O.E. Rolvaag. All are welcome at the book club as participants can attend every meeting or just the ones for the books that interest you. Books are available to check out at the library.

A kick-off bouncy house and carnival will mark the start of the Summer Reading Program on Saturday, June 1. Games and prizes to win will be awarded while logs will be given at the carnival. Wayne Public Library hours include Monday through Thursday from 10 a.m. – 8 p.m.; Friday from 10 a.m. – 6 p.m.; Saturday between 10 a.m. – 4 p.m. and the library will be open on Sundays from 2 – 5 p.m. Summer hours will begin on Sunday, May 26 with the library being closed each Sunday until the Fall.

The Wayne Public Library will be closed on Saturday, May 25 for cleaning and closed on Monday, May 27 in observance of Memorial Day.
